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Prize Winning Berry Rhubarb Crumble
Step 1: Preheat the Oven and Prepare the Pan
Begin by preheating your oven to 375°F. While the oven heats up, grease a 13×9-inch baking pan with butter or non-stick spray. This step is crucial as it will prevent the rhubarb crumble from sticking, ensuring a beautiful, easy release once it’s baked.
Step 2: Prepare the Fruit Mixture
In a large mixing bowl, combine sliced fresh rhubarb, strawberries, and blueberries. Sprinkle in granulated sugar, cornstarch, and balsamic vinegar, then gently toss the fruits to thoroughly coat them. This process should take just a few minutes and will help create a juicy filling for your rhubarb crumble, bursting with flavor.
Step 3: Transfer to the Baking Pan
Once the fruits are well-mixed, transfer the vibrant fruit mixture into the prepared baking pan. Spread it evenly across the bottom, making sure the fruits are distributed nicely. This step sets the stage for the crumble topping, which will create a delightful contrast once baked.
Step 4: Make the Crumble Topping
In a separate bowl, whisk together all-purpose flour, sugar, salt, and sliced almonds. After thoroughly mixing the dry ingredients, beat in a large egg and melted unsalted butter, stirring until the mixture is crumbly yet cohesive. This topping is what gives the rhubarb crumble its delightful crunch and rich flavor, so make sure it’s well combined.
Step 5: Assemble the Crumble
Crumble the topping mixture generously over the sugared fruit in the baking pan. Allow the fruit mixture to peek through the topping for that rustic look. As you layer it on, drizzle the crumble with additional melted butter to enhance its golden-brown finish and flavor, ensuring it bakes up beautifully.
Step 6: Bake to Perfection
Place the baking pan in the preheated oven and bake for 35-40 minutes. Watch closely as the topping turns golden brown and the fruity juices bubble up around the edges. The tantalizing aroma filling your kitchen will signal that your rhubarb crumble is nearing its delicious end, promising a delightful treat.
Step 7: Cool and Serve
Once the crumble is baked to golden perfection, remove it from the oven and let it cool slightly for about 10-15 minutes. This cooling period allows the filling to set, creating the perfect texture for serving. Enjoy it warm, ideally topped with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or a dollop of whipped cream for a truly indulgent experience!

How to Store and Freeze Rhubarb Crumble
Fridge: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. This helps retain the crumble’s texture and flavor.
Freezer: For longer storage, wrap the cooled rhubarb crumble tightly in plastic wrap, then place it in a freezer-safe bag or container. It can be frozen for up to 3 months.
Reheating: To enjoy your rhubarb crumble again, thaw it overnight in the fridge, then reheat in a preheated oven at 350°F for about 15-20 minutes, until warmed through.

Make Ahead Options
These Prize Winning Berry Rhubarb Crumbles are perfect for meal prep! You can prepare the fruit mixture (rhubarb, strawberries, blueberries, sugar, cornstarch, and balsamic vinegar) up to 24 hours ahead, storing it in an airtight container in the refrigerator to maintain its freshness. The crumble topping can also be made in advance and stored separately for up to 3 days in the fridge. When you’re ready to bake, simply assemble the fruit mixture in your prepared pan and crumble the topping over it. Drizzle with melted butter before baking, and you’ll enjoy a delicious, homemade dessert with minimal effort—even on bustling weeknights!

Expert Tips for Rhubarb Crumble
• Fresh Ingredients Matter: Always opt for fresh rhubarb and berries to enhance the flavor of your rhubarb crumble; frozen can work but may alter texture.
• Mixing Technique: When combining the fruit mixture, toss gently to avoid crushing the berries, ensuring a visually appealing dish with varied textures.
• Coating Adjustments: If using frozen berries, add a little extra cornstarch to the fruit mixture to prevent excess liquid from forming during baking.
• Topping Texture: For the perfect crumble topping, mix until it’s just combined; overmixing can lead to a dense crust instead of a light and crunchy finish.
• Mind the Oven: Keep an eye on your rhubarb crumble during the last few minutes of baking, as oven temperatures can vary and you don’t want it to over-bake.
• Cooling Time: Allow the crumble to cool for at least 10-15 minutes before serving; this will help the filling set and make for easier serving.

What if my crumble topping is too crumbly?
If your crumble topping is too crumbly and isn’t forming nicely, it may be due to using too much flour or not enough fat. To fix this, add a small splash of melted butter or even a bit of water, just until the mixture holds together better. Make sure you don’t overmix when combining ingredients, as this can lead to a denser topping.

Irresistible Rhubarb Crumble with Crunchy Almond Topping
Ingredients
Equipment
Method
- Preheat your oven to 375°F and grease a 13x9-inch baking pan.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ine sliced rhubarb, strawberries, blueberries, sugar, cornstarch, and balsamic vinegar.
- Transfer the fruit mixture into the prepared baking pan and spread it evenly.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, salt, and almonds. Beat in the egg and melted butter until crumbly.
- Crumble the topping mixture over the fruit in the baking pan and drizzle with melted butter.
- Bake for 35-40 minutes until the topping is golden brown and juices bubble up.
- Remove from oven and let cool for 10-15 minutes before serving.
